Top attractions near Croscombe

Croscombe, located in Wells, England, offers a delightful blend of culture and outdoor experiences, perfect for eco-friendly holidays. Visitors can explore historic houses and sites that showcase the area’s rich heritage, as well as breathtaking canyon gorges that invite outdoor adventures. Whether you're travelling with family or seeking a solo retreat, Croscombe's attractions provide a memorable experience steeped in history and natural beauty.

  • Cheddar Gorge: A stunning limestone gorge offering breathtaking scenery and outdoor adventures. Explore the dramatic cliffs and enjoy hiking trails with panoramic views, perfect for nature enthusiasts.
  • Wells Cathedral: A magnificent Gothic cathedral renowned for its stunning architecture and historical significance. Experience the serene atmosphere and intricate details of this cultural landmark.
  • Chalice Well: A tranquil historic site known for its healing waters and beautiful gardens. Visitors can explore the peaceful surroundings and reflect at this spiritual destination.

Exploring the natural features in Croscombe

Whether you're looking for adventure or just want to appreciate the scenery, Croscombe is a great spot to appreciate mother nature. Here are a few of the area's noteworthy features, all within 30 miles (48.2 km) of the city centre:

  • Wookey Hole Caves (4.2 mi / 6.8 km)
  • Mendip Hills (8.5 mi / 13.7 km)
  • RSPB Ham Wall (9.1 mi / 14.7 km)
  • Cheddar Gorge (9.6 mi / 15.5 km)
  • Chew Valley Lake (9.7 mi / 15.6 km)
  • Chew Valley (10.9 mi / 17.5 km)

Travelling to and around Croscombe

The nearest airport is in Bristol International Airport (BRS), located 14 mi (22.5 km) from the city centre.
